What are the Different Types of SEO?

SEO encompasses a range of strategies aimed at improving a website’s ranking and visibility on search engines. The three main types of SEO are:

  • On-Page SEO
  • Off-Page SEO
  • Technical SEO

1. On-Page SEO: Optimizing Individual Webpages

On-page SEO focuses on optimizing elements on your website’s pages to make them more search engine-friendly. This includes optimizing content, meta tags, internal linking, and keyword usage. By enhancing on-page factors, you increase your chances of ranking higher for relevant search queries.

Key Elements of On-Page SEO

  • Primary Keywords: Use primary keywords strategically in titles, headings, and throughout the content.
  • Meta Tags Optimization: Ensure your meta title and description are optimized with relevant keywords.
  • Content Optimization: Focus on creating high-quality content that answers the user’s search intent, using secondary keywords, long-tail keywords, and LSI (Latent Semantic Indexing) keywords.
  • URL Structure: Ensure URLs are clean, descriptive, and include relevant keywords.

2. Off-Page SEO: Building Your Website’s Authority

Off-page SEO refers to actions taken outside your website to improve its ranking, such as link building and social media engagement. This type of SEO focuses on boosting your website’s domain authority and trustworthiness through external signals.

Key Strategies for Off-Page SEO

  • Link Building: Acquiring backlinks from high-authority websites helps boost your site’s credibility and SEO ranking.
  • Social Media Engagement: Active participation in social media platforms can drive traffic and improve brand visibility.
  • Influencer Outreach: Collaborating with influencers in your niche can increase your reach and improve your website's reputation.

3. Technical SEO: Optimizing the Backend

Technical SEO ensures that your website’s backend is optimized for search engine crawlers, improving crawling, indexing, and user experience. This includes optimizing site speed, mobile responsiveness, and website security.

Key Elements of Technical SEO

  • Page Load Speed: Ensure fast page loading times to improve user experience and reduce bounce rates.
  • Mobile Optimization: Make your website mobile-friendly, as mobile optimization is a key ranking factor for Google.
  • Structured Data (Schema Markup): Implement schema markup to help search engines understand the context of your content better.
  • XML Sitemap: Ensure your website has a clear and up-to-date XML sitemap for easy indexing.

Understanding Different Types of Keywords for SEO Strategy

Effective SEO strategies require proper keyword research. Keywords can be classified into different types based on user search intent. Understanding these keyword types will help you create content that meets user expectations and improves your search rankings.

1. Primary Keywords: The Core of Your SEO Strategy

Primary keywords are the main focus of your SEO efforts. They are the most important and relevant terms that describe the core theme of your webpage. For example, if you're running a website about SEO, "SEO strategies" could be a primary keyword.

2. Secondary Keywords: Supporting Your Main Focus

Secondary keywords support the primary keyword and help diversify your content. These are often related terms or phrases that further explain the main topic. For example, "website visibility" or "enhance SEO rankings" could be secondary keywords in the context of SEO strategies.

3. Long-Tail Keywords: Targeting Specific Search Queries

Long-tail keywords are longer, more specific keyword phrases that cater to a more defined audience. These keywords are less competitive but can attract high-intent visitors. For example, "how to improve website visibility using SEO strategies" is a long-tail keyword.

4. LSI Keywords: Helping Google Understand Context

LSI (Latent Semantic Indexing) keywords are terms related to your primary keyword. They help Google understand the content’s context better. Using LSI keywords helps you rank for related searches and improves overall content relevance.

5. Search Intent Keywords: Aligning with User Needs

Search intent refers to the reason behind a user’s search. The three main types of search intent are:

  • Informational: The user is seeking information or answers to a question (e.g., "What are SEO strategies?").
  • Navigational: The user is looking for a specific website or page (e.g., "LetsUpdateSkills homepage").
  • Transactional: The user intends to make a purchase or take action (e.g., "Buy SEO tools online").
